The Social Benefits and Drawbacks of Casino Gambling
Casino gambling has long been a subject of social debate, balancing economic benefits with potential societal harms. On one hand, casinos can create jobs, generate tax revenue, and boost local economies. On the other, gambling may contribute to addiction, financial instability, and social disruption among vulnerable populations. Understanding the social implications of casino gambling requires a nuanced approach, considering both the positive contributions and the challenges it poses to communities.
Many view casinos as entertainment hubs that foster social interaction and leisure activities. They often act as venues for social gatherings and can promote tourism, drawing diverse groups of people together. However, the rise of gambling addiction linked to casinos remains a serious concern. Studies indicate that a small percentage of gamblers develop problematic behaviors that strain personal relationships and increase the burden on social services. Balancing regulation and responsible gambling initiatives is vital to mitigate these risks while preserving the benefits casinos offer.
